Output adb60e99f6aa860ffdf4bfa3b1f882ff2831f120b17af08498c9bc77b584f496:0

value
1020188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65154ad85b519a577e2feb2036da79140e2fb19 OP_EQUAL
address
3MEDxZEjDAhz1STnrCaq15PvTrrjNnLin7
transaction
adb60e99f6aa860ffdf4bfa3b1f882ff2831f120b17af08498c9bc77b584f496
confirmations
434285
spent
true